Hair Alcohol Testing

In Oberon, North Dakota, hair alcohol testing detects long-term alcohol consumption trends over approximately a three-month window. It works by measuring fatty acid ethyl esters (FAEEs) and ethyl glucuronide (EtG), ensuring an accurate reflection of usage patterns. This method is ideal for workplaces or legal cases requiring ongoing consumption histories.

Blood Alcohol Testing

Blood alcohol testing is a precise method to measure the concentration of alcohol within the bloodstream. Used widely in serious situations where accuracy is paramount, such as DUI cases or post-accident tests in Oberon, North Dakota, it provides clear results to assess alcohol impairment levels.
